Plexiglass would work. Use GE Silicone 1. Safe for use in aquariums/Fish. It no longer says so on the tube, though. They now sell this for an insane amount in a tiny tube and other manufacturer's name on it, targeted specifically at the fish hobbyist.
Be sure to buy GE silicone 1 and not 2 or 1*. It's for Windows and Doors. Not Bathroom/Showers. The latter has a mold preventative of some sort. You don't want that. Allow to cure for a couple days.
